1. The Shaaras were responsible for these fictional accounts of the American Civil War. What was the relationship between these two men?

Answer: Father and Son

2. Which work does not belong to the Shaara trilogy?

Answer: The Stonewall Brigade

3. Which book was the work of Michael Shaara?

Answer: The Killer Angels

"Gods and Generals", a prequel to "The Killer Angels", was written by his son, Jeffrey Shaara,who also wrote "Last Full Measure" to complete the trilogy. "The Stonewall Brigade is by James I. Robertson.
4. Killer Angels was the first novel of the trilogy to be published, in 1974. However, its historical chronology would not rank it first. Which novel would rank first chronologically from beginning to end?

Answer: Gods and Generals

5. The trilogy centers around several Civil War generals one of which was Joshua Chamberlain. Unlike many of the other main characters, Chamberlain was not a career military person. What was his occupation before the war?

Answer: College Professor

Chamberlain was a professor of religion and philosophy at Bowdoin College in Maine. He later became Gov. of Maine after his exploits in combat. He became famous for holding the flank of the Union Army at Gettysburg and accepting the ceremonial surrender to end the war.
